The more I read on Green, the more I think going to end up really liking him just in time for the Mavs to trade him on Friday.

I do think he is a different skillset defensively than Bey. I think he's just a better athlete who has recoverability and can cover more explosive wings and combo guards. Bey is a big strong frame guy, but probably not as explosive. Bey is a very good shooter who can shoot over close outs with his length. Green is maybe more versatile with what he can do in a motion offense.

Just depends what type of defense you want with the pick.

This guy helps the most against quickness...quick enough to keep up with Murray, Dame, etc, and his SIZE will be GREAT against those guys. 

Bey helps a lot more against Kawhi, Lebron and guys like that. a LOT more. He's bigger, stronger. 

Bey is also 1,000x more ready to walk in an play (probably start) on day 1.

Long term, we might end up liking Green a lot, but he's raw.
